I recently saw Yeossal and Epaulet offer matching pants for some of their chore coats and safari jackets. This is a bit different from casual suit options in more relaxed fabrics such as linen or corduroy that maintain similar jacket details found in a more formal suit (e.g. notch or peak lapel, 2-3 buttons).
I've seen old photos of men wearing chore coats or safari jackets with matching pants, but it usually looks like it was part of a work uniform. I can't recall ever seeing someone wear this kind of get up as a stylistic choice. What do you all think? Is this a good alternative to other casual suit styles or are these types of jackets best worn with separates? Do any of you wear workwear style jackets with matching trousers?
